Can I use the SIM card I already have in an Unlocked Mobile Phone?

Buying a new Phone through a contract can be a cost effective way to upgrade. Rather than paying the full cost of the Phone upfront, it can be paid off in instalments on a regular phone bill. In exchange, the Phone that you buy will be locked to that network during the contract's term. For locked phones, you cannot freely swap SIM Cards for other network providers until you have met the conditions needed to unlock it, usually only if the contract's time has expired or you have paid a release fee to the provider. The existing network provider will be able to provide these details.

Purchasing a Unlocked Phone outright may cost more initially but it gives the flexibility to use any a SIM Card for any network. If you already have a SIM Card from a previous Phone, you may want to keep that and carry it over into your new Phone as it may have contacts, photos and other personal files saved to it.

SIM Cards themselves come in three sizes; standard, micro and nano. Networks can generally send out new sizes free of charge and some Multi SIM cards can be size adjusted as needed. eSIM cards are also starting to become popular as digital options for maximum flexibility and no more awkward removals or installations.

Is 5G faster than NBN?

5G internet is the next generation of Mobile Network infrastructure. This new technology standard builds on the capabilities of 4G to deliver faster speeds, more reliable connections and close to zero latency. In Australia, 5G infrastructure is still being rolled out and it may not be readily available outside of major metropolitan areas. To access 5G you will need a 5G Compatible Phone or smart device and a 5G plan with your service provider, in addition to coverage in the area where you are.

Location, service provider and the type of plan you are on are factors that influence the costs, data limits and speeds available for home and Mobile Internet. As it currently stands 5G can theoretically reach speeds of up to 20 gigabytes per second, around 200 times faster than the 100 megabytes per second speeds NBN currently offers to most Australians. 5G is limited by potential downtime along with short range but can be a viable substitute for home NBN and broadband.

iPhone vs Android: what’s the difference?

Choosing between an iPhone or an Android Smart Phone will largely come down to personal preferences and how you want to use your device, with each having their own strengths.

iPhones are manufactured by Apple and run off Apple’s iOS operating system. Because Apple controls the hardware and software design, the tech and operating system that make up and iPhone complement each other for high efficiency. Apple products are designed to work together in simple and useful ways, with many Phone Accessories designed for iPhones.

Android is a Google made operating system and unlike Apple’s iPhone, Android Phones are designed and manufactured by a wide variety of companies like Samsung, Motorola and Google to name a few. Because of this, most of the Mobile Phones on the market today are Android OS and this gives users a much wider selection of products to choose from across budget and premium prices. Newer Android Phones use the USB-C standard of cables, which are standard across most newer tech products aside from Apple.

What should I look for in a Smart Phone?

Camera quality is improving all the time in Smartphones. In addition to high resolution lenses, Mobile Phones come with a range of features that make quality, high-definition photography quick and easy. Some models have a dedicated camera button that lets you respond quickly to snap the perfect shot. Front facing cameras are great for making video calls or taking selfies but can be easy to overlook amongst the cutting edge features of the main camera.

If you find yourself using your Phone to consume media a lot, then it’s worth looking at models with larger, high resolution screens that will best display high quality YouTube or streamed videos. If you want to watch video or listen to music on your commute, a larger capacity battery will help ensure your Phone will keep you entertained on your trip home, even after a long day out. If you have Headphones, then you may want to check that your new Phone has a 2.5 / 3.5mm audio jack or Bluetooth connectivity for Wireless Headphones.
